St Bartholomew's Hospital
Uncover the sinister intersection of medicine and crime at St Bartholomew's Hospital, one of London's oldest hospitals, dating back to 1123. Explore the historical context of grave-robbing and its connection to medical practices, and hear unsettling tales of how the hospital's doctors may have interacted with London's criminal underbelly. Discover the grim realities of Victorian-era medical research and its shadowy connections.
